Verb:
make believe with the intent to deceive
Ex: He feigned that he was ill
behave unnaturally or affectedly
Ex: She' s just acting
state insincerely
Ex: He professed innocence but later admitted his guilt
put forward a claim and assert right or possession of
Ex: pretend the title of King
put forward, of a guess, in spite of possible refutation
Ex: I am guessing that the price of real estate will rise again
(theater) represent fictitiously, as in a play, or pretend to be or act like
Ex: She makes like an actress
Adjective:
imagined as in a play
Ex: the make-believe world of theater
